Welcome to support for Gildhall, the seat-map renderer used by the Marrowlight Theatre chain. The renderer draws seat availability from a nightly snapshot, so if a customer reports a seat showing as open that's actually sold, check the snapshot age first — anything over 26 hours is stale. Refunds and holds are handled upstream; we only render. To access the diagnostics panel for a venue, you'll need the passphrase below.

strongbox words: ulaael-wenix

**Handover: Font vendoring — Quillmark app**

For the eng sync: I've finished vendoring the third-party display fonts into the Quillmark build so we no longer fetch them at runtime. Licenses are tracked in the vendored manifest; please keep it updated if fonts are swapped. The build step verifies checksums at compile time, so CI will fail loudly on tampering. The verification step reads the following configuration values.

deployment values, tafof-taduf:
pelius:
  pin: 6508
  tenant: praiel
  seal: seal_4e33a2f4
  metrics_host: metrics.pelius.plorvagrid.corp
  standby_team: druix
  escalation: juldor-norius
  nonce: 5db598

This page documents break-glass access for the Wirecord gateway, which external plugin authors may need when websocket compression negotiation deadlocks a session. Note the tradeoff: permessage-deflate reduces bandwidth on the Oakhollow edge nodes but can stall under memory pressure, which is the usual trigger for a break-glass event. Before forcing a session reset, authenticate to the emergency console, which will ask for the recovery passphrase shown directly below.

vault phrase of bagaf-kajeg = jorath-feniel-briir-siliel-ralix

## Configuration

Slimforge plugins read settings from a `.env` file in the plugin directory. Set `SLIMFORGE_TARGET` to the registry you want trimmed images pushed to, and `SLIMFORGE_LAYERS` to cap layer count. Plugins that publish to the shared cache must authenticate. Place the cache access secret issued during plugin registration on the following line.

sealed setting: RELAY_SECRET5=82864